Garcinia Cambogia: Fact or Fiction?
Garcinia cambogia has gained significant attention in recent years as a potential weight loss supplement. Proponents maintain that this extract from the rind of the Garcinia gummi-garum fruit can control appetite, boost metabolism, and stop fat production. However, the scientific evidence to support these statements is mixed.
Some studies have shown that garcinia cambogia may slightly reduce body weight and waist circumference, but the outcomes are often small. Moreover, many studies lack rigorous design, making it challenging to draw firm conclusions about its effectiveness.
The primary active compound in garcinia cambogia is hydroxycitric acid (HCA), which is believed to work by blocking an enzyme called citrate lyase, involved in fat production. Despite this, more studies are needed to fully understand the actions underlying garcinia cambogia's potential effects on weight loss.
Unleash the Power of HCA: Garcinia Cambogia for Metabolism Boost
Garcinia cambogia has become a popular slimming supplement. This tropical fruit boasts a compound called hydroxycitric acid (HCA), this is believed to enhance metabolism and aid in controlling appetite.
Numerous studies have shown the potential benefits of HCA for weight management. It's thought to function through a variety of mechanisms, including: inhibiting an enzyme called citrate lyase, which is involved in fat creation; and elevating serotonin levels, a neurotransmitter that can control appetite.
Despite this, it's important to keep in mind that research on HCA is not conclusive. More research are needed to confirm its impact and potential side effects.
